Hampstead falls within a designated Conservation Area, under the authority of Camden. This means that certain basement conversion works — particularly those affecting the external appearance of a property — may require prior approval or must use materials that are sympathetic to the area's character. Planning and building regulations in Hampstead (NW3) are administered by Camden Council. For basement conversion work that affects structure, drainage, electrical safety, or gas installations, Building Control sign-off is typically required. The conservation area designation in Hampstead means external changes need additional approval. We advise on all regulatory requirements at the quotation stage and ensure full compliance.

Does a basement conversion need planning permission in Hampstead?
In most cases, basement conversions that don't change the external appearance of the property are permitted development. However, in Hampstead's conservation areas or for listed buildings, planning consent may be required.
